@charset "utf-8";
/* CSS Document */
body,h1,h2,h3,h4,h5,h6,p,dl,dd,ol,form,input,textarea,th,td,select{ margin:0;}
em{ font-style:normal;}
li{ list-style:none;}
a{ text-decoration:none;}
img{ border:none; vertical-align:top;}
table{ border-collapse:collapse;}
input,textarea{ outline:none;}
textarea{ resize:none; overflow:auto;}
body{ font:12px "微软雅黑";background: #fbf7f4;}

.w100{width:100%;background:#f8f3ee;float: left;}
.w100 .picture{height: 450px;width: 100%;overflow: hidden;}
.picture img{width: 2520px; height: 450px; margin:0 calc(50% - 1260px);padding: 0;}
/*.picture img{width: 100%;padding: 0;}*/
.w1000{width:1000px;margin:0 auto;background: #fbf7f4;}
/*.w1400{width:1400px;margin:0 auto;background: #fbf7f4;overflow: hidden;}*/
.top{width: 100%;background: #f8f3ee;height:90px;line-height: 95px; }
.top .logo{position:absolute; z-index: 999;}
.top img{margin-top: 15px;float: left;}
.top_one{float: right;}
.top_two{float: left;}
.top_one img{margin-top: 25px;}
.top_one2 img{margin-top: 36px;margin-right: 5px;}

#main_nav{width: 79%;height: 50px;float: left; margin:0 auto;}
#main_nav ul {width: 100%;margin:0;padding:0;list-style:none;white-space:nowrap;text-align:center;}
#main_nav ul {display:inline-block;}
#main_nav li {margin:0;padding:0;list-style:none;}
#main_nav li {display:inline-block;display:inline;text-align:center;height:30px;line-height:30px;width: 15%;}
#main_nav li.L0{margin-right: 1.5%;border-radius: 15px;}
#main_nav ul ul {position:absolute;left:-9999px; z-index: 10000;background:#F9CDB8;margin-top:4px;}
#main_nav ul.U0 {margin:0 auto;}
#main_nav ul.U0 li.L0 {float:left;display:block;position:relative;}
#main_nav b {position:absolute;}
#main_nav a {display:block;font:normal 11px verdana, arial, sans-serif;color:#666;line-height:25px;text-decoration:none;padding:0 20px;}
#main_nav ul.U0 li.L0 a.L0-a {float:left;}
#main_nav ul li:hover > ul {visibility:visible;left:0;top:21px;}
#main_nav ul ul li:hover > ul {visibility:visible;left:100%;top:auto;margin-top:-25px;margin-left:-4px;}
#main_nav li.left:hover > ul {visibility:visible;left:auto;right:0;top:25px;}
#main_nav li.left ul li:hover > ul {visibility:visible;left:auto;right:100%;top:auto;margin-top:-25px;margin-right:-4px;}
#main_nav a:hover ul {left:0;top:23px;}
#main_nav li.left a:hover ul {left:auto;right:-1px;top:23px;}
#main_nav li.left ul a {text-align:right;}
#main_nav a:hover a:hover ul, #main_nav a:hover a:hover a:hover ul {left:100%;visibility:visible;}
#main_nav li.left a:hover a:hover ul, #main_nav li.left a:hover a:hover a:hover ul {left:auto;right:0;visibility:visible;}
#main_nav a:hover ul ul, #main_nav a:hover a:hover ul ul {left:-9999px;}
#main_nav li.left a:hover ul ul, #main_nav li.left a:hover a:hover ul ul {left:-9999px;}
#main_nav li a.drop {background:transparent url(../images/white-down.gif) no-repeat right center;}
#main_nav li a.fly {background:transparent url(../images/white-right.gif) no-repeat right center;}
#main_nav li.left ul a.fly {background:transparent url(../images/white-left.gif) no-repeat left center;}
/*#main_nav li a:hover, #main_nav li a.fly:hover {color:#fff;background-color:#ea3434;}*/
#main_nav li:hover > a, #main_nav ul li:hover {color:#fff;background-color:#ea3434;font-weight:bold;}
#main_nav li.L0 a.A0 {border-radius: 15px;}
#main_nav ul.U1 li a:hover{background: #ea3434;font-size:1.1em;}
#main_nav table {position:absolute;height:0;width:0;left:0;border-collapse:collapse;margin-top:-6px;}
#main_nav table table {position:absolute;left:99%;height:0;width:0;border-collapse:collapse;margin-top:-30px;margin-left:-4px;}
#main_nav li.left table {position:absolute;height:0;width:0;left:auto;right:0;border-collapse:collapse;margin-top:-4px;}
#main_nav li.left table table {position:absolute;left:auto;right:100%;height:0;width:0;border-collapse:collapse;margin-top:-30px;margin-right:-4px;}

.body{width: 100%;}
.body ul{padding: 0;width: 100%;margin:  0 auto;background: sienna;}
.body ul li{list-style-type: none;width:49.2%;height: 256px; margin-top: 55px; border-radius: 5px;float: left;display: block;}
.body ul li>b{position: relative;  top: 6px;}
.body_two .body_three b{margin-left: 0px;}
.body ul li b{font-size: 1.9em;color: #6d5747;margin-left: 15px;}
.body ul li img{margin: 0 0 0 18px;}
.body_two{width: 90%;height: 190px;background:#fcfbf5;margin: 10px 25px;border-radius: 5px; background: #ffffff no-repeat 20px 0px;}
.body_three{width: 100%;height: 30%;}
.body_three img{float: left;}
.body_three b{font-size:18px;float: left;margin-top: 8px;}
.body_four{width: 100%;height: 70%;}
.qq{width: 45%;height: 40%;z-index: 1000; color: #000000;word-wrap: break-word; font-size: 1.3em;margin-left: 8%;}
.body_five{width: 30%;height: 30px;line-height: 30px; background: #ffdc1f;float: left;z-index: 1000;margin-left: 8%;border-radius: 15px;margin-top: 5%;/*box-shadow: 1px 1px 1px 1px #979797;*/text-align: center;float: left;}
.body_four a{color: white;}
.body_four a:hover{color: white;}
.body_four img{float: right;}

.foot{width: 100%;float: left;margin-top: 38px;}
.foot ul{clear: both;padding: 0;}
.foot ul li{list-style-type: none;height: 250px;float: left;font-size: 15px;width: 124px;}
.foot ul li:nth-child(2){ width:  250px;  }
.foot ul li a{width:125px;display: block;float: left; line-height: 30px;color: #666;font-size: 14px;min-width: 125px;}
.bottom{width: 100%;height: 50px;float: left;border-top:1px solid #e6e6e6; text-align: center;line-height: 50px;color: #666;font-size: 12px;}
.dibu{height: 370px;min-width: 125px;max-width: 250px;}

.about{width: 100%;height:auto;min-height:880px;background:url('../images/p1.png') no-repeat bottom; display: inline-block; padding-bottom: 150px;}
.about_left{width: 730px;float: left;min-height: 660px;}
.about_left span.title, .about span.title{height: 36px;font-size: 2.1em;color: #fff; padding-left: 35px; padding-right: 20px;margin-top: 30px;display: inline-block;background:url('../images/a6.png') no-repeat;}
.about-b {margin-left: 0; width: 100%; float: none; display: block;}
.about-a {margin-left: 0; text-align: center; display: block;}
.cc{width: 730px;height: 210px;margin-top: 20px;}
.about_left img{border-radius: 5px;}
.about_left p{font-size: 14px;}
.about_left b{/*font-size:20px;text-align:center;display:block;*/}
.about_left span.title b, .about span.title b{padding-right:15px;height:36px;font-size: 1em;background: #e60012;display: inherit;}
.about_left h5{margin-top:55px;color:red;font-size:16px;}
.about_left a{font-size:14px;color:#666666;}

.gun_images{position:relative;width:648px;height:126px;margin:10px auto;overflow:hidden;}
.gun_images .prev,
.gun_images .next{display:block;position:absolute;height:53px;width:20px;float:left;top:37px;left:5px;}
.gun_images .next{left:auto;right:5px;}
.gun_images ul{width:580px;height:128px;float:left;overflow:hidden;zoom:1;}
.gun_images ul li{float:left;margin-left:14px;width:182px;overflow:hidden;padding:0 10px;}
.gun_images ul li img{width:182px;height:120px;display:block;background:url(../images/loading.gif) center center no-repeat;border:solid 1px #fff;}

.chongtiao{width:100%;padding: 25px;}
.chongtiao:after {content:".";display:block;height:0;clear:both;visibility:hidden;}
.chongtiao:after {visibility:hidden;display:block;font-size:0;content:"";clear:both;height:0;}
.chongtiao ul li{width: 100%;float: left;border-radius: 3px;padding:20px;}
.chongtiao ul li img{float:left;width:263px;height:151px;border:#fff 4px solid;border-radius:12px;box-shadow:-2px 0 2px #ccc,3px 0 3px #ccc,0 -2px 2px #ccc,0 3px 3px #ccc;}
.chongtiao ul li div.r{float:right;width:610px;}
.chongtiao ul li div.r h6{color:red;font-size:22px;font-weight:normal;padding-top:5px;padding-bottom:10px;}
.chongtiao ul li div.r p{color:#444444;font-size: 16px;overflow:hidden;height:70px;margin-bottom: 10px;}
.chongtiao ul li div.listtime{font-size:16px;}
.chongtiao ul li div.listtime span{color:#444444;float:left;}
.chongtiao ul li div.listtime b{color:red;float:right;margin-right:20px;}

.new{width:100%;height: 544px;/*float: left;*/}
.new ul li{width:234px;height:256px;background:white;float:left;margin:8px;border:solid 1px #ece5e0;border-radius:3px;padding:5px;}
.new ul li img{border:none;width:216px;height:160px;}
.new ul li p{margin-top:-0.1px;color:#333;}
.more{width:45px;height:20px;background:#ea3434;color:white;font-size:10px;text-align:center;line-height:20px;margin-top:10px;}
.zz{color: #999999;float:right;font-size:12px;margin-top:-20px;}

.news{width:730px;float:left;}
.news ul li{width:31%;height:234px;background:white;float:left;margin: 8px;border:solid 1px #ece5e0;border-radius:3px;padding:5px;}
.news ul li a{width:100%;height:234px;}
.news ul li a img{width:100%;border:none;/*margin-left:40px;*/}
.news ul li a p{color:#666;text-align:center;margin-top: 10px;}
.wo-hide{display:none }
.wo-hide2{}
.wo-div{display:none }
.about_right{width:27%;float: left; margin-top: 28px;}
.topss{width: 100%;float: right; }
.tops{background:url('../images/r_1.png') no-repeat right;width: 100%;height: 53px;float: right;margin-bottom: 10px;}
.tops p{text-align:center; line-height: 38px;font-size: 1.75em;margin-left: 10%;color: #fff;font-weight: bold;}
.topss ul li{list-style-type: none;border-bottom:1px dotted #979797; width: 100%; float: left; /*height: 34px;*/padding-top: 8px;}
.topss ul li a{color: #333;height: 20px;line-height: 16px;float: left;}
.topss ul li a:hover{color:red;}
.topss ul li img{margin-right: 5px;margin-left: 10px;float: left;}
.bottoms{width: 100%;float: left;margin-top: 20px;}
.bottoms img{float: right;padding-right: 5px;margin-top: 5px;}
.border{width:230px;height: 130px;float: right;border: 1px #979797 solid;margin-top: 10px; margin-right: 8px;}
.borders{width:230px;height: 230px;float: right;margin-top: 10px;}
#pic{width: 45%;height: 45%;background:white;float: left;margin: 5px;border: solid 1px #f1dddd;}
#pic img{padding-right: 17px;margin-top: 10px;width: 90px;height: 90px;}

.bb{color: #333333;font-size: 14px;width: 730px;height: 45px;line-height: 45px;border-bottom: solid 1px #e7e4e1;float: left;z-index: 11;}
/*.bb a{float: left;z-index: 555;}
.bb a:hover{color: #333333;}*/
.bb span{font-size: 12px;float: right;display: block;color: #999999;z-index: 10000;line-height: 45px;margin-top: -0.1px;}

.container{width: 100%;margin: 0 auto;overflow:hidden;}
.row{padding-left: 0px!important;padding-right: 0px!important;width: 74%;float: left;border: none;}
.row span{font-size: 22px;color: #000000;margin-top: 30px;margin-top: 30px;  display: inline-block;}
/*
.product ul li img{width:18%;margin-right: 5px;}
*/
.hide{display: none}
.show{display: block}

.product-text table{border: 0;margin: 0;padding: 0;font-size: 14px;line-height: 200%;}
.product-text h3{line-height: 35px;padding: 0;margin: 0;overflow: hidden;white-space: nowrap;text-overflow: ellipsis;color: #333;font-size: 18px;}
.product-text table tr .attr{width:90px;color:#999;}
.product-img{margin-top:10px;padding:0;}
.product-img li{float:left;margin-right:10px;}
.product-con{margin:50px auto 0;width:100%;font-size:14px;}
.product-con h3{height:35px;line-height:35px;border-bottom:1px #e6e6e6 solid;margin-bottom:10px;margin-left:10px;}
.product-con h3 .icon{border-left:2px #e14848 solid;display:block;float:left;height:14px;margin-left:-10px;margin-top:10px;}
.product-con p{margin-top:0;line-height:22px;}

#ff ul {width:50%;float:left;}
#ff ul p{float:left;color:#666666;font-size:13px;line-height:20px;}

.oem_bottom{width:100%;float:left;}
.oem_bottom span{line-height:50px;}
.oem_bottom p{color:#666666;margin-top:10px;}
#gg ul{width:30%;float:left;}
#gg ul p {float:left;color:#666666;font-size:13px;line-height:20px;}

.poster-main{position:relative;}
.poster-main a,.poster-main img{}
/*.poster-main .poster-list{width:1920px;height:352px;}*/
.poster-main .poster-list li a{list-style-type:none;border-radius:5px;}
.poster-main .poster-list .poster-item{position:absolute;left:0;top:0;margin:0 auto;display:block;}
.poster-main .poster-btn{position:absolute;top:0;width:100px;height:270px;z-index:10;cursor:pointer;opacity:0.8}
.container {margin:0px auto;}
.am-slider-default .am-direction-nav .am-prev{display:none;}
.am-slider-default .am-direction-nav .am-next{display:none;}
.am-slider-default .am-control-thumbs li{width:18.5%;margin-right:9px;}
.am-slider .am-slides img{width: 2520px;height:500px;margin:0 calc(50% - 1260px);}
.am-slider-default .am-control-thumbs img{opacity:1;border:solid 1px #f1dddd;padding:3px;}
.am-slider-default .am-control-thumbs{padding-top:20px;background:#fbf7f4;}
.am-slider .am-slides li{border:solid 1px #f1dddd;height:500px;width:100%;overflow:hidden;/*margin:auto;left:50%;margin-left:-1260px;*/}
.am-slider-default .am-control-thumbs{margin:0;}
.wo-active{background-color:#0e90d2;color:#fff;}

/*.am-control-thumbs li{width: 20%;}*/
h1 {margin-bottom:30px;text-align:center;font-size:30px;}

#on{color:white;width:30px;height:30px;text-align:center;line-height:30px;margin-left:11px;}
#om{/*width:30px;height:30px;*/background:#e34343;text-align:center;line-height:30px;}
.fy{width:100%;/*float:left;margin-left:-50px;*/}

.message{width:100%;}
.message legend{text-align:center;border:none;margin:0;font-size:22px;}
.message span{text-align:center;display:block;font-size:14px;}

.message button{margin-left:46%;width:80px;height:30px;margin-top:30px;line-height:27px;font-size:16px;background:#e62129;border-radius:15px;color:#fff;}
.messages{width:60%;margin:0 auto;border:1px solid #e60012;background:white;border-radius:15px;}
.messages p textarea{width:100%;height:150px;}
.messages p input{border:none;line-height:30px;}

.trace{width:100%;}
/*
.product{width:74%;float:left;border:none;}
*/
.product{background:url(../images/p_b.png) no-repeat;width:714px;height:537px;padding-left:0px;position:relative;}
.scrollleft{width:28px;height:79px;padding-left:25px;padding-top:160px;float:left;}
.scrollright{width:28px;height:79px;float:right;padding-top:160px;margin-right:25px;}
#moreleftDIV{width:560px;height:330px;position:relative;overflow:hidden;left:43px;float:left;}
#moreleftDIV #slide2 li{padding-top:10px;float:left;width:560px;/*height:411px;*/}
#moreleftDIV #slide2 li .sl_le{width:240px;max-height:362px;float:left;}
#moreleftDIV #slide2 li .sl_le img{max-width:240px;max-height:362px;}
#moreleftDIV #slide2 li .sl_ri{width:290px;float:left;}
/*#moreleftDIV #slide2 li .sl_ri_top{width:250px;height:120px;}
#moreleftDIV #slide2 li .sl_ri_font{width:310px;height:208px;float:left;}*/
#moreleftDIV #slide2 li .sl_ri h1{font-size:14px;color:#484848;}
#moreleftDIV #slide2 li .sl_ri p{font-size:12px;color:#484848;}
#drop{/*left: 50%;transform:translate(50%,0);*/height:120px; position:absolute; top: 310px;width:100%;}
/*#drop ul{position:relative;text-align:center;padding-left:0;margin:1.5rem 0;list-style:none;clear:both;content:" ";display:table;}*/
#drop ul li{display:inline-block;margin-right:15px;}
#drop ul li img{display:block;float:left;max-width:75px; max-height:113px; }
#drop ul li .actt img{max-width:80px;max-height:120px;margin-left:15px;}
.c_r b {color:red;}

.material{padding:0;width:100%;display:inline-table;}
.material li{padding:5px;margin:5px;float:left;width:31%;border:1px solid #ccc;background:white;}
.material li a{width:100%;height:auto;text-align:center;}
.material li img{width:100%;}
.material li span{width:100%;height:26px;text-align:center;display:block;}
.material li b{margin-left:10px;margin-bottom:10px;float:left;width:50px;height:20px;font-size:14px;}

.Pro_pin{margin:0px auto;width:660px;}
.Pro_pin ul{list-style-type:none;float:left;display:inline;clear:both;}
.Pro_pin ul li{float:left;height:83px;margin:3px;}
.Pro_pin ul.OC li{height:124px;}

.Pro_pin ul li a{height:124px;}
.Pro_pin ul li a img{/*height:124px;*/}
.Pro_pin ul li a:hover{}
.Pro_pin ul li a:hover img{border:3px #fff solid;}

.top_wx{z-index:11000;float:left;height:25px;width:25px;margin-top:18px;margin-right:10px;position:relative;line-height:25px;}
.top_wx a{display:inline-block;}
.top_wx img{height:25px;width:25px;}
.top_wx a:hover img{float:left;height:150px;width:150px;}